// Don't pick up the system glxext.h; use our own, which is better.
#define __glxext_h_
#include <GL/glx.h>
#if defined(GLX_VERSION_1_4)
// If the system header files give us version 1.4, we can assume it's
// safe to compile in a reference to glxGetProcAddress().
#define HAVE_GLXGETPROCADDRESS 1
#elif defined(GLX_ARB_get_proc_address)
// Maybe the system header files give us the corresponding ARB call.
#define HAVE_GLXGETPROCADDRESSARB 1
// Sometimes the system header files don't define this prototype for
// some reason.
extern "C" void (*glXGetProcAddressARB(const GLubyte *procName))( void );
#endif
// This must be included after we have included glgsg.h (which
// includes gl.h).
#include "panda_glxext.h"
// drose: the version of GL/glx.h that ships with Fedora Core 2 seems
// to define GLX_VERSION_1_4, but for some reason does not define
// GLX_SAMPLE_BUFFERS or GLX_SAMPLES. We work around that here.
#ifndef GLX_SAMPLE_BUFFERS
#define GLX_SAMPLE_BUFFERS 100000
#endif
#ifndef GLX_SAMPLES
#define GLX_SAMPLES 100001
#endif
// These typedefs are declared in glxext.h, but we must repeat them
// here, mainly because they will not be included from glxext.h if the
// system GLX version matches or exceeds the GLX version in which
// these functions are defined, and the system glx.h sometimes doesn't
// declare these typedefs.
#ifndef __EDG__ // Protect the following from the Tau instrumentor.
typedef __GLXextFuncPtr (* PFNGLXGETPROCADDRESSPROC) (const GLubyte *procName);
typedef int (* PFNGLXSWAPINTERVALSGIPROC) (int interval);
#endif // __EDG__
